Ticket #4471 — Signature check failing on GH-West controller

Heads up for newcomers: the Fernloop greenhouse controller started rejecting sensor-drift calibration bundles last night. Turns out the old cert expired, not actual drift weirdness. Re-sign the calibration package and redeploy — should clear it. For reference, the current signing key is as follows.

deploy key for kajof-fajop: bky6_gDHw9Q

Welcome to the rotation. Quick heads-up: the Fernwick Java SDK lags the Go SDK by two releases — batch uploads and retry hooks are missing. Expect tickets blaming the API; check SDK version first before escalating. Parity gaps are tracked per-feature, with workarounds listed. The matrix lives at the page below.

dashboard of yaguf-hahig = https://grafana.urlaqworks.test/secrets

## Step 4: Cut over the proctoring queue

Once the Veralith exam-proctoring workers on the new cluster report healthy, drain the legacy queue by setting its intake flag to read-only. In-flight proctoring sessions will finish on the old workers; new sessions route to the replacement consumers automatically. Expect up to ten minutes of dual operation. If the backlog on the legacy side exceeds 500 sessions, pause and page the Queensmere platform lead. Apply the following configuration values to the new consumer group before enabling intake.

config for yadug-kawep:
ralwyn:
  log_level: debug
  metrics_host: metrics.ralwyn.qorvellabs.internal
  pool_size: 4